One thing I've learned as I've grown to understand spiritual things more in my Christan walk, is no amount of evidence can persuade someone to accept the gospel.
Time after time, the Bible credits God's grace and the work of the Holy Spirit with the fact that people believed the gospel. You can show a person 100% of the evidence and proof they need to believe that what the Bible says about Jesus is true, but that is not enough to see them saved.
A heart change is mandatory, and only God can do that.
That's why we plant the seeds, but God gives the increase.
That being said, that is why you should not waste time arguing for Creation or the Existence of God with an atheist. Those topics are just rabbit trails that the atheist will want to drag you down. Instead, just be straight forward about the gospel message: We are guilty sinners and God, out of mercy, sent Christ to take the place of sinners, and by repenting of sin and putting our trust/faith in Christ, we can be saved.
